This national title is the pinnacle of high school girl’s travel basketball and is the biggest summer tournament of the year (which is Nike sponsored). The tournament includes some of the best talent across the nation and a who’s who of Tennessee players. About 85% of the Flight Silver roster included in-state players which is unusual for exposure programs of this caliber. (Not to underplay the two out-of-state players [FL / MS] that was absolutely critical to the success of the team.)

First of all Dub, congratualtions to Flight Silver for winning the end of the year Nike Championship. It is a great accomplishent and you must be a very proud papa. But to be fair for those less familiar with this event, we need to clarify some things:

 

Nike Nationals is the pinnacle of "Nike" basketball, not travel ball in general. While there is a ton of talent on these teams and several college coaches in attendance, it is an invitation only event limited to 20 Nike sponsored teams. While there have been other non-Nike teams invited in the past, it is unusual. At the same time Nike Nationals was going on, Adidas Nationals was being held. I'm sure their champion feels as if they are the national champion of travel ball. The same could be said of the Michael T White events and AAU. Perhaps instead of national champions you should refer to yourself as Nike Nationals Tournament Champions or Nike National Champions. To truly be a national championship an event should be open to all comers, and I think you would admit there are some very competitive teams who are not sponsored by Nike.

 

I'd also take exception to the comment of the team's makeup being a who's who of TN talent. There are great players on this team, primarily from middle and east tennessee. However, there are also great players that play for other teams across the state and region, so it is a bit of a slight to them to suggest that they are in some way inferior to the girls on this team.

Congratulations to the Tennessee Flight Silver for winning Nike Nationals. It must have been an amazing tournament.

 

In a doing some research looking back at Hoopgurlz. The Flight won this tournament over teams that included: DFW Elite - winners of Boo Williams Best of the Best and the Chicago Summer Showcase, Boo Williams - winners of the Orlando AAU Showcase and the Washington D.C. US Junior Nationals, West Coast Premiere - winners of the Cincinnati Nike Midwest Showdown, Cal Swish - wiiners of the Oregon City End of the Trail and the Memphis River City Classic, NY Elite - Silver Bullets - winners of the 16U AAU Nationals in Orlando.

 

I am always proud of Tennessee teams that do well. This is a great accomplishment.
